The Use of Vacuum Forming Technology in Packaging
Vacuum forming technology is widely used in the packaging industry due to its ability to create a variety of packaging types with high precision, durability, and efficiency. This process allows for the production of packaging that not only protects the product but also makes it visually appealing. Vacuum forming is used in various packaging sectors, including food, cosmetics, medical products, and many others.
1. Food Packaging
One of the most common applications of vacuum forming is in the production of food packaging. The technology allows for the creation of airtight, impact-resistant packaging materials that help extend the shelf life of products and maintain their freshness.
Blister Packaging: This packaging consists of transparent plastic cavities (blisters) that form a protective shell around the product. It is often used for packaging small items such as candies, chocolates, frozen foods, and pharmaceuticals. Vacuum forming allows for the creation of blisters with precise shapes and sizes, ensuring reliable protection from external factors.
Containers for Sandwiches, Fresh Products, and Fruits: Vacuum forming is used to create clear plastic containers for sandwiches, fruits, salads, and other fresh items. These containers are airtight, helping to preserve freshness and prevent contamination.
2. Packaging for Cosmetics and Personal Care Products
Vacuum forming is also widely applied in the packaging of cosmetics and personal care items. Transparent plastic containers and packaging with precise shapes provide an attractive appearance and ease of use for the products.
Jars and Bottles for Creams and Lotions: Plastic packaging made using vacuum forming is ideal for storing cosmetic products such as creams, face masks, and various lotions. Vacuum forming ensures that the packaging is durable and aesthetically pleasing.
Boxes and Containers for Toiletries: Packaging for soap, toothpaste, and other toiletries is often produced using vacuum forming. This allows for the creation of lightweight and sturdy packaging materials with precise dimensions and shapes.
3. Medical Packaging
Vacuum forming is also widely used in the production of packaging for medical products. In the medical industry, packaging must not only be functional but also safe, protecting products from external contaminants and ensuring sterility.
Packaging for Medical Instruments and Consumables: To protect medical instruments such as syringes, needles, catheters, as well as various sterile consumables, vacuum-formed packaging is often used. This process ensures airtight packaging that protects the items from external factors.
Blister Packaging for Tablets: Blister packaging, often used for tablets and capsules, is also produced through vacuum forming. Each cavity precisely fits the size of the tablet, facilitating storage and transportation of medical products.
4. Packaging for Electronics and Household Appliances
Vacuum forming is used for the packaging of electronic devices and components such as mobile phones, tablets, computers, and various small household appliances. This packaging needs to be durable and protect products from damage during transport and storage.
Casing and Packaging for Mobile Devices: Vacuum forming is commonly used for packaging mobile phones and other gadgets. It creates packaging that fits the product perfectly, protecting it from impacts and other damages, while also looking attractive.
Packaging for Small Household Appliances: Small appliances like hairdryers, vacuum cleaners, and blenders are often packaged in plastic containers produced by vacuum forming. This ensures reliable protection during transportation.
5. Packaging for Home Goods and Hobby Products
Vacuum forming is also used to package various home goods, toys, and hobby materials. The advantage of this process is its ability to create packaging with intricate shapes and high precision.
Toy Packaging: Vacuum forming is used to create packaging for toys, where protection and visual appeal are important for consumers. Plastic containers and blisters made through this method are ideal for packaging toys of various shapes and sizes.
Packaging for Household Items: Household products such as containers, tools, and home accessories are often packaged using vacuum forming. This allows for the creation of durable and convenient packaging materials.
